Things are happening in Ole Miss football recruiting. 

The Rebel wide receivers room was already an embarrassment of riches. But the addition of Izaiah Hartrup (Southern Illinois), who committed on Friday, adds even more firepower. He posted 706 receiving yards last season.

Camp season is underway. Ole Miss is also hosting a number of top high school prospects on campus this weekend, including a couple of official visitors.

The Rebels currently boast the No. 16 overall recruiting class in the country, as updated by On3 on Saturday. Leading the way is a quartet of four-stars, including wide receiver Jerome Myles, Utah’s top prospect

Myles recently jumped 161 spots to five-star status on 247. Myles is ranked No. 118 nationally by the On3 Industry Ranking, which takes into account rankings from the four major recruiting service. He’s the No. 15 wide receiver.

Myles was sidelined for a portion of last season after breaking his ankle Week 2. He still finished with 486 yards and six touchdowns on 19 receptions. Myles had five receptions for 121 yards and two touchdowns in leading Corner Canyon to a 6A state championship.

“He has great size and strength so he won’t get knocked off routes,” Eric Kjar said, Myles’ high school head coach, said. “Ball skills are elite (and) top-end speed is elite. 

“He’s a very physical blocker. Great teammate, too.”

OLE MISS MEN’S BASKETBALL TO PLAY IN RADY CHILDREN’S INVITATIONAL

The second season of the Chris Beard era for Ole Miss men’s basketball will include an appearance by the Rebels in the 2024 Rady Children’s Invitational. 

LionTree Arena is hosting the tournament on the campus of UC San Diego from November 28-29. The remainder of the field is as follows: Purdue, NC State and BYU. The Boilermakers and Wolfpack each reached the Final Four last season. BYU earned a bid as an NCAA Tournament six-seed. Ole Miss won 20 games for the first time since 2018-19.

Formatting for the event consists of two games daily, with championship and third-place games November 29. FOX or FS1 will broadcast all games and tipoff times will announced later.

TWO OLE MISS TRACK AND FIELD ATHLETES NAMED TO SEC COMMUNITY SERVICE TEAM

Ole Miss track and field veterans Iangelo Atkinstall-Daley and Kyla McLaurinwere named to the SEC Community Service Team this week. 

Atkinstall-Daley, a junior, has been active in and around the Oxford/Lafayette community over her Rebel career. She served Adopt-a-Basket, which is an athletic department initiative that donates more than 100 Thanksgiving baskets to area families in need. Other efforts include: Ole Miss’ morning carpool program; Feed the Sip; A Night to Shine; a water drive for Jackson (Mississippi) residents; and Books and Bears. 

McLaurin helped with the aforementioned causes, too, but she also volunteered with Reading with the Rebels, Hygiene Hijack and the CASA Back to School event. 

Atkinstall-Daley was one of the 14 Ole Miss entries for the upcoming 2024 NCAA Outdoor Championships. The tournament will run June 5-8 at the University of Oregon’s Hayward Field.
